Badge of Awesome Communities invites you to share your favourite things to see and do in cool destinations around the world. We caught up with the folks from Argyle Fine Art — one of our featured attractions from Nova Scotia — to learn about what they have to offer.
What makes Argyle Fine Art awesome?
Argyle Fine Art: Argyle Fine Art has been in business for 18 years, and in that time we always strive to make our gallery the most awesome by creatively reaching out to people from all walks of life to share in the power of original art! Although we are a commercial art gallery and our primarily focus is to sell artwork by our amazingly talented artists we also play an important role in our city: We expose. We create community. We educate. We inspire.
We are especially interested in exposing our visitors to the unique styles of art being created by our Atlantic Canadian artists. Our artists are some of the best in the world- at least that’s what our visitors tell us. We showcase a variety of styles of art from fine to folk and emerging artist to established. New works arrive each week, new interactive window displays are switched up each Thursday and full new exhibits happen each month. There’s always something happening at Argyle Fine Art! We want to expose our artists and visiting artists to new opportunities.
We love collaborating with other businesses in our community as well as supporting select local charities. We have many events at the gallery that get people more engaged with art and complimentary businesses. We’ve hosted chocolate parties, wine tastings, we’ve had a beer made by a local brewery and launched during a recent opening with the label created by one of our artists, we’ve hosted breakfast openings with local cafes, yoga, readings, we’ve had drawing days with live animals like owls and more to support charities like Hope for Wildlife and more!
